Known areas for improvement

system issues

  • Linux / Linking - relocation processing is very slow ( ogg video, odp slides ) two possible ways to fix that
    • re-ordering symbol & elf hash tables to improve cache locality, lots of good & simple ideas here.
    • -Bdirect implementation [1] - gaining little traction.
  • Linux / I/O scheduling & pre-loading is poor

General I/O & memory issues

  • Config mgr - scattered files
  • UI configuration - tons of scattered files
  • .rdb files - loads of empty space, mmap + random access pattern
